    Its called "Demon seed"

    I admit it,I have been seduced by this sci-fi classic, there isn`t much to say, except this: Demon seed is a must see film!.

    Demon Seed contains critical and political views on the technology in the future (or the present for that matter).

    With an megalomaniac computer which takes over a house, and even get pregnant with the human lady of the house(played by Julie Christie) this movie contains suspense at the best.

    The computer takes over the house....but will the computer (which is called Proteus,if I remember correctly)take over the world...the answer is within each viewer.

    Not unlike Hal in 2001 the error is caused...as always by human behaviour.

    The director of this masterpiece; Cammell, deserves a lot of credits for Demon Seed. The movie is a golden moment in the film history!
